Student Services Coordinator

3 weeks ago


Edmonton, Canada Reeves College Full time

We are happy to say that we are looking for an experienced **Student Service Coordinato**r to join our team at **Reeves College - Edmonton, AB**

**Reporting to**: The Campus Director

**Job Type**: Full Time
**Hours**: 8:00am - 5 pm PST
**Software Knowledge**: Microsoft Suite and Excel is a must
**Address**: Suite 103 9910 39 Avenue Nw, EDMONTON ALBERTA T6E 5H8
**Pay**: $38-40 k

**WHAT WILL YOU DO?**

Specifically, the Student Services Coordinator will be responsible for:

- Contributing to and monitoring the quality of the student academic experience
- Supporting the administrative functions of the campus to enhance the student experience
- Acting in a manner that upholds the College standards
- Performing other related duties as required

**WHY ARE YOU A GREAT FIT?** Qualifications**

To be successful in the Student Services Coordinator position, individuals must be committed to developing, maintaining and demonstrating the following:
**Education and Experience**:

- Completion of post-secondary education.
- A minimum of three years' office experience in a service-oriented environment.
- Experience in a private post-secondary environment considered an asset.
- An equivalent combination of education and experience will be considered.

**Skills and Abilities**:

- Strong interpersonal skills
- Keyboarding speed at 40wpm with accuracy
- Solid working knowledge of MS Office including Word, Excel, Outlook and ability to troubleshoot minor computer problems
- Excellent organizational skills with ability to multi-task
- Ability to use various office equipment including fax and photocopy machines
- Ability to handle a multi-line telephone switchboard
- Ability to complete work in a timely manner with accuracy and attention to detail
- Ability to work independently with minimum supervision
- Good judgement and ability to prioritize assignments
- Ability to work under pressure and maintain a calm focus during hectic periods
- Knowledge of the provincial Student Assistance Program
- Understanding of the programs and services provided by the organization
- Ability to exhibit a professional attitude and image with a commitment to quality service

**Provisos**:

- Overtime during peak periods may be required
